We are seeking a dynamic and motivated Brand Promoter to join our team. The ideal candidate will be a confident, persuasive communicator who can represent Nexmos Design and our clients’ brands in a professional and engaging manner. This role requires a proactive individual capable of building relationships, executing promotional campaigns, and driving brand awareness in diverse markets.

Responsibilities:

  • Promote and represent company and client brands at events, trade shows, and in-market activations.

  • Develop and maintain strong relationships with potential and existing clients.

  • Assist in planning and executing marketing and promotional campaigns.

  • Monitor and report on campaign performance and market feedback.

  • Collaborate with internal teams to ensure brand consistency across all channels.

Qualifications



Qualifications

: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Business, Communications, or related field preferred.

  • 1–3 years of experience in brand promotion, marketing, or sales.

  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.

  • Excellent interpersonal skills and ability to work independently or as part of a team.

  • Highly organized with attention to detail and time management skills.

 

Additional Information



Benefits:

  • Competitive salary ($55,000 – $59,000 per year)

  • Opportunities for professional growth and career advancement

  • Skill development through hands-on experience and training

  • Collaborative and supportive work environment

  • Full-time position with standard employee benefits
